Show that positive odd integral powers of a skew-symmetric matrix are skew-symmetric and positive even integral powers of a skew-symmetric matrix are symmetric.

Text Solution

AI Generated Solution

To show that positive odd integral powers of a skew-symmetric matrix are skew-symmetric and positive even integral powers of a skew-symmetric matrix are symmetric, we can follow these steps: ### Step 1: Definition of Skew-Symmetric Matrix Let \( A \) be a skew-symmetric matrix. By definition, this means: \[ A^T = -A \] ...
